CPHQ Flashcards Patient Safety I (1-17)

AB
Effective program evaluationbegins with in-depth assessment of all aspects associated with safety of organization
Primary goal of patient safetyprevention of harm thru methodical analysis of previously harmful events
How to accomplish goal of patient safetysystematic review of policies/procedures both directly and indirectly related to pt. safety
NPSNational Patient Safety
National Patient Safety goalsestablished by the Joint Commission in 2002
3 main principles of risk management assessmentassessment, avoidance and control
risk assessmentwhat happened and why?
first step of 3 main principles of risk managementrisk assessment
second step of 3 main principles of risk assessmentrisk avoidance
3rd step of 3 main principles of risk managementrisk control
risk avoidancewhat specific actions, policies, procedures would prevent this type of incident in future?
risk controldevelop measure to increase quality of care thru adaptation of specifc control measures
Human-factors engineeringdiscipline that develops devices & technology based on physical/psychological needs of those who use them
Human-factors engineering akaErgonomics
Usabilityexplains how a device is used in a real-world situation
Forcing functionsprevents one step from being completed without a prior necessary step
advantages of being a high-reliability operatorreliance on practical experience, loyalty in adversity, outcome-focused approach, emphasis on operationalized definitions of expected outcomes, deeper-dive perspective when problems arise
Systems thinkingholistic approach to risk management investigating incidents based on how separate systems in network influenced outcome
Incident report review stepsread incident report, interview, analyze everything & id contributing factors
best way to prevent infection spreadproper hand hygiene
considered synonymous with risk managementpateint safety
Six Sigmaspecific technique works to improve business processes by tools/concepts to reduce errors and eliminate waste
tools used to determine why goals not achieved or discrepancy between expected results & actual resultsGap analysis, Root cause analysis, Cause-and-efect diagram
Validationmethod that monitors a process from start to finish to ensure same results occur every time
looks at ea. step within a process to ensure consistency & predictabilityValidation
Transparencyvital component of communication that builds trust
Data Collectionspecifc process of sourcing information
Risk Managementprocess that identifies potential risks within a process
